Format text for output as markup.
class markup formatter
Declaration: markup formatter
Announcements: markup formatter
Direct supertypes: text formatter
import ideal • machine • elements • runtime util
static CLOSE SELF CLOSING TAG : " />"
Declaration: CLOSE SELF CLOSING TAG
Declaration: constructor
Declaration: constructor
Declaration: constructor
Declaration: process string
Direct overrides: text formatter
Indirectly overrides: text visitor
Declaration: process element
Direct overrides: text formatter
Indirectly overrides: text visitor
Declaration: do indent
private void do unindent()
Declaration: do unindent
Declaration: process special
Direct overrides: text formatter
Indirectly overrides: text visitor
private void write start tag(text element element, readonly dictionary[attribute id, attribute fragment] attributes)
Declaration: write start tag
Declaration: write end tag
private void write self closing tag(text element element, readonly dictionary[attribute id, attribute fragment] attributes)
Declaration: write self closing tag
Declaration: write tag attributes
Declaration: write escaped